Potions and Enchantments:
Potions and enchantments play a crucial role in PvP combat, offering players buffs and enhancements that can turn the tide of battle. Brewing and utilizing potions strategically, as well as enchanting gear for added protection and offensive capabilities, are essential aspects of mastering PvP in Minecraft PC 1.8.

Strafing and Dodging:
Movement is crucial in PvP combat. Strafing, which involves moving side to side while attacking, makes it harder for opponents to land hits. Dodging, which involves quick movements to avoid attacks, can also be an effective strategy to minimize damage taken.

Combos and Critical Hits:
Mastering combo attacks and critical hits can significantly increase damage output. Combos involve stringing together consecutive hits without giving opponents a chance to counterattack. Critical hits occur when players time their attacks perfectly, resulting in additional damage.
Notable PvP Communities and Servers:
Badlion Network:
The Badlion Network is a well-known PvP-focused server that offers a competitive PvP environment. It features ranked matches, tournaments, and leaderboards, allowing players to showcase their skills and compete against top-tier PvP enthusiasts.
Hypixel Network:
Hypixel Network, one of the largest Minecraft servers, offers a wide range of game modes, including PvP-centric games. From classic PvP battles to team-based modes like BedWars and SkyWars, Hypixel Network provides an immersive and competitive PvP experience for players.
Mineplex:
Mineplex, another popular Minecraft server, features a variety of PvP minigames and modes. Players can engage in intense team battles, conquer objectives, and test their skills against other PvP enthusiasts.
Ultra Hardcore (UHC) Servers:
Ultra Hardcore servers provide a unique PvP experience, often incorporating elements of survival and permadeath. In UHC, players must gather resources, craft gear, and engage in battles until only one player or team remains standing.
Joining the PvP Playground:
To immerse yourself in the thrilling world of PvP on Minecraft PC servers running 1.8, follow these steps:
- Launch Minecraft and select "Multiplayer" from the main menu.
- Click on "Add Server" to enter the server details, including the server IP address and port number.
- Save the server details, select the server from your server list, and click "Join Server" to connect.
- Once connected, explore the server's PvP offerings, join battle arenas, or participate in PvP events.
